Project Assistant, IDEA

ICON is a global healthcare intelligence and clinical research organisation united by a mission to bring new medicines and treatments to patients faster.

As a values-driven organisation, integrity, collaboration, agility, and inclusion are at the heart of how we work and interact with each other, customers, patients and suppliers.

As a Project Assistant, Inclusion, Diversity, Equity, and Access (IDEA) at ICON, you will provide vital support in coordinating project activities, managing administrative tasks, and facilitate communication across departments.

What You Will Do:

Your role will involve delivering inclusion, diversity, and equity work to a high standard, working closely with your team and stakeholders.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Supporting the IDEA project managers and teams by scheduling meetings, preparing agendas, and documenting action items and meeting minutes.
  • Managing project documentation and ensuring all relevant files, records, and data are up to date and accessible to the team.
  • Coordinating communication between cross-functional teams and departments to facilitate the smooth execution of projects.
  • Tracking project timelines, milestones, and deliverables to ensure projects remain on schedule and addressing any issues that arise.
  • Assisting with the preparation of reports, presentations, and other materials to support project progress and decision-making.

Your Profile:

You will bring relevant inclusion, diversity, and equity experience, along with the following qualifications and skills.

Required qualifications and exper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in business, technology, or a related field is preferred, though relevant experience in project administration or support within tech-driven projects is acceptable.
  • Excellent organizational and multitasking skills, with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ple project tasks effectively.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with a collaborative approach to working across departments and diverse teams.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and familiarity with project management tools is advantageous.
  • Detail-oriented, proactive, and adaptable, with a strong commitment to supporting innovative and data-driven projects.
  • Willingness to travel as required (approximately 5%)
